Default Aeroforce Interceptors

Anybody have one of these in a 99-07 truck with forced induction?
If so does it read boost?
Got a customer with a turbo truck and wanting one of these. Not sure if it showed boost with a 2/3 BAR Map.

They show boost. I ran one years and years ago when I owned a supercharged grand prix, it worked great. If the MAP sensor can read boost and the computer can see that value, the areoforce should show it.

I set it up to cycle through 8 different channels every 4-5 seconds or whatever the time frame was and with a push of a button I could stop it and select what channel I wanted to view.

I have an older PT201 V2 in the 2000 with a 2barSD OS. IIRC it reads the correct MAP value in kPa. There are no customizable PIDs so it will not display a "Boost PSI" value above barometric pressure.
